Introduction
The RocketLinx MC5001 is a serial to fiber media converter with an RS-232/422/485 port with auto sensing baud rate and direction control functions. It extends the distance of serial communication to 5KM (MC5001, Multi-Mode) or 40KM (MC5001, Single-Mode) and also provides good immunity for EMI/EMC. The RocketLinx MC5001 supports 15KV ESD protection on the serial line. It also features a wide power input range (12-48VDC/12-32VAC) and DIN rail mounting for quick and easy installation.

Mounting the RocketLinx MC5001
DIN Rail mount: screw on the DIN rail mounting clips with the four screws and mount MC5001 on the DIN Rail.
Grounding the RocketLinx MC5001
There is one earth grounding pole included on the power input connector. Connect the earth ground of the MC5001 to ensure system safety and to prevent noise.
Wiring the Power Inputs
1. Insert the positive and negative wires into the V+ and V- contacts on the terminal block connector.
2. Tighten the wire-clamp screws to prevent the power wires from being loosened.

Note: The recommended working voltage is 24VDC (12-48VDC) or 24VAC (12-32VAC) with polarity reverse protection.
Connecting to serial line
The MC5001 provides triple mode circuits for RS-232/422/485 2/4-wires and extends these signals to 5KM or 40KM by optical fiber cable. The converter operating architecture can also be configured as a PTP (Peer to Peer) or SFR (Serial Fiber Ring) to enlarge the serial communication infrastructure and link additional MC5001s. To ensure the quality of the serial line signal, the MC5001 provides two termination resistors for the RS-422/485 TX and RX signal by using the DIP switch enable/disable option. Connecting the Optical Fiber
The Fiber Optical link architecture supports PTP and SFR mode for different purposes.
PTP Mode (Peer to Peer)
The PTP (Peer to Peer) mode provides connection between 2 nodes. When working in this mode, the MC5001 can transmit and receive data at the same time, which means the MC5001 is working at full-duplex mode.
